Apply Goth Eyeshadow

Dressing up the eyes is an important factor when going goth and eyeshadow can quickly be over or underdone. Whether you are just beginning your goth style, dressing up for a special occasion or looking to perfect your goth style, you can learn how to apply goth eyeshadow for that essential dramatic look by reading the following steps. Instructions

    • 1

      Choose a light color of shadow as the foundation and at least three darker shades for the actual goth look. Remember that dressing up goth is based around black so make sure your darkest color is pure black. Other dark colors you might consider are greens, reds, blues and grays.

    • 2

      Brush a light-colored eyeshadow evenly onto the lid, as the base of your goth look. For cool skin tones use a slightly gray or blue base and for warm skin tones use a light beige. It is important that this color blends well with the skin tone and is not too dark as it is just meant to be the foundation for your real goth eyeshadow. Apply the base to all parts of the eyelid, from corner to corner and lid to eyebrow.

    • 3

      Apply your second color which will be the undertone of your eyeshadow. Apply the color from lid to eyebrow and corner to corner, shaping the eye as you would like it to look. Use your eyeshadow brush to apply the third color, this time applying slowly and blending as well as possible. Only apply the second color up to a few centimeters below the eyebrow.

    • 4

      Finish your goth eyeshadow with black. Begin at the eyelid and slowly work your way up as you can quickly overdo the black. Blend the black into the other colors only working up to the fold of the eye. You have now mastered the most important element when dressing goth.

    This article doesn't mention contouring, which is very important, whether you're gothic or not. If you follow those directions exactly, you're just going to have caked on layers of several eyeshadows. Start with an actual eyeshadow primer. Several are on the market. Then, put the lightest color shadow on as your browbone highlight; apply under eyebrow and almost down to crease. Apply medium shade over lid and in crease. Now take the black shadow and apply in outer half of crease and outer quarter of lid, then take a fluffy brush and blend so there are no harsh lines between colors anywhere. After the shadow, apply your eyeliner, mascara, and brow pencil.
